Dust (http://dust.tt) helps companies build AI teammates that work across their organization. Founded by former OpenAI researcher Stanislas Polu (@spolu) and his team, the company has spent the last three years building AI for work while the capabilities of frontier models have advanced at breakneck speed.
At Startup School Paris, YC’s @collinmathilde sat down with Stanislas to talk about what it takes to build alongside frontier AI labs, why staying model agnostic is a competitive advantage, how AI is changing the way we work, and why the best startups are built around a problem founders can’t stop thinking about.
